‘Next Goal Wins’ to Premiere at TIFF

The Toronto International Film Festival (TIFF) announced the first 60 films that will head the festival this year, with Taika Waititi’s long-delayed Next Goal Wins amongst them. The full festival line-up is expected to be around 200 films.

TIFF 2023 will take place Thursday, September 7, through Sunday, September 17.

Next Goal Wins is based on the 2014 documentary of the same name by Mike Brett and Steve Jamison. It tells the story of about Dutch-American football (soccer) coach Thomas Rongen’s efforts to push the American Samoa national team, considered one of the weakest in the world, to qualify for the 2014 FIFA World Cup. 

Next Goal Wins will be in theaters on November 17. Stay tuned for updates on Next Goal Wins and the TIFF schedule.
